Aston Martin teams up with Lucid Motors to develop electric powertrains
- Aston Martin will pay Lucid $232 million for the rights to use its electric vehicle technology.
- Lucid will provide Aston Martin with electric motors, batteries and charging units for Aston Martin's future electric vehicles.
- Lucid will receive a 3.7% stake in Aston Martin, becoming a shareholder in the company.
- Aston Martin plans to launch its first electric vehicle in 2025 as part of a $2.5 billion sustainability strategy.
- The partnership will allow Aston Martin to build a dedicated electric vehicle platform for all its future electric models.
